Converting a DWG drawing directly into a functional PAT file requires transforming lines, arcs, and points into a specific text-based definition format that CAD software can interpret. This guide will walk you through the most effective methods to achieve this. What is a PAT File?

Clean geometry is the secret to a successful conversion. If your DWG file is messy, the resulting PAT file will glitch, break, or freeze your computer. What is a PAT File

There are three primary ways to handle this conversion, depending on whether you want to extract an existing hatch or create a brand new pattern from geometry you’ve drawn. 1. Extracting Patterns with LISP Routines
